Overall Meaning

The lyrics of America Gomorrah's song "Revelation" are about the end of the world as described in the biblical book of Revelation. The singer is trying to warn the listener of the impending destruction and chaos that will come when Jesus returns to Earth. The message is that even though the idea of the world ending can be scary, it's important to know that it's going to happen and to prepare accordingly. The lyrics describe the devastation and destruction that will accompany the end of the world, including the fall of Babylon and the weeping of its merchants and great men. The singer also mentions the fact that sin and iniquity have separated humanity from God, and that this separation is ultimately what will lead to the end of the world.


The chorus of the song expresses the singer's hope and anticipation for the return of Jesus, who will take him home. The singer is not afraid of the destruction and chaos that will come with the end of the world, but instead is excited for the day when Jesus returns.


Overall, the lyrics of "Revelation" are a warning to listeners about the end of the world and a call to prepare for the return of Jesus. They also express the singer's hope and anticipation for that day.
